From f13fb77a1d5510599a3a092b5ac8fafc0395c032 Mon Sep 17 00:00:00 2001 From: Dmitry Badovsky Date: Fri, 7 Nov 2025 10:32:03 +0000 Subject: [PATCH] Add khl.yaml --- khl.yaml |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) create mode 100644 khl.yaml diff --git a/khl.yaml b/khl.yaml new file mode 100644 index 0000000..23bd4af --- /dev/null +++ b/khl.yaml @@ -0,0 +1,29 @@ +#cloud-config +hostname: HOSTNAME +manage_etc_hosts: true +fqdn: HOSTNAME +user: root +disable_root: False +password: $5$aRlGK2LC$QP4pRWLj.16HYUG5VZPi.6IwJeAIX7QUnqNWxovVsG1 +ssh_authorized_keys: + - 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ABgQC0jrPt0N1XFasjfXjfnVp41mDjkDh1dK/PSA5dfrhnQg2FxDdL+RuZWaDiJ0zzVztGOAwrl+2mOwJBQY/dp2INl0ouRQ/Du9HkGnH/r9wFRVyCaMvphrSkr2VTsFbbS51wTRa7MPh8B8vyfMsWzqNr0gtvJBuYoxVBhTXG3b9Zr9wgfilmYQPhOAWOq5J6DqQby2FwmlyAoRvnCpWcXsbLiPqBmxtV7C6LS+suhSCpnaDWCPpnE8Aj1PETrHf6TdIJxL89YW4h/I2mlmWusrGkEYJpvar6BIKMcpPjBYH1Jgs3ELv96AEyG0julu6Tz8U7LTkFknXrB1jJF8YBFicXw3dLG10Ayez+abZvh0lAj1a8DwHDr0RSO3nTM3E/mOTrpdHn8Pq/xDRgatvdo/f9WsCTHCpDPDeIjYch6H1czGfUGx6i2yqxslawz9JLKoYv+tPS0s1jfSoSz/gcAmk4a3wjRDqBi2PAxjKLkBXgf5aZ5HH6G7sti/GVRCoI33U= dbsky@gfx +chpasswd: + expire: False +package_upgrade: true +packages: + - qemu-guest-agent + - git + - net-tools + - python3 + - python3-pip + - python3-venv +runcmd: + - systemctl enable --now qemu-guest-agent + - timedatectl set-timezone Europe/Moscow + - crontab -e + - (crontab -l; echo "$(ip a | grep 10.10.35 | cut -d ' ' -f 6 | sed "s|/|.|g" | cut -d '.' -f 4) 3 * * * /sbin/shutdown -r now") | crontab - + - mkdir /mnt/khl + - echo "khl /mnt/khl 9p trans=virtio,ro,_netdev 0 0" + - mount -a + - git -C /root clone https://git.tvstart.ru/ychernenko/KHL.git + - bash /root/KHL/deploy.sh \ No newline at end of file